Output 71bd3aada81586fc9271ecd953e3240a5199f840087d52d7d894a24963b27848:3

value
655500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f6bb3d2605ce9fadeaccf49d584f0a761e8cdcf OP_EQUALVERIFY OP_CHECKSIG
address
1JT95wGDNvz93WJsb84wX9bagjtVvsnzAG
transaction
71bd3aada81586fc9271ecd953e3240a5199f840087d52d7d894a24963b27848
confirmations
321314
spent
true